Current concepts of amniotic fluid dynamics
American Journal of Obstetrics and Gynecology, 1980Amniotic fluid at term in the human is the product of numerous exchanges with the fetal and indirectly, the maternal compartments. Our current information on the formation, circulation, and removal of this fluid is limited but provides an interesting concept of the steady-state regulation of this space.

Fluid Bolus for Renal Colic: Current Practice
Urology Practice, 2015Historically the administration of intravenous fluid boluses in patients with urolithiasis and acute renal colic has been a standardized practice in the emergency department as a part of a conservative approach. In theory, an intravenous fluid bolus may promote ureteral fluid flow.

The propagation of a gravity current into a linearly stratified fluid
Journal of Fluid Mechanics, 2002The constant initial speed of propagation (V) of heavy gravity currents, of density ρC, released from behind a lock and along the bottom boundary of a tank containing a linearly stratified fluid has been measured experimentally and calculated numerically.
